there was a guy pulling it this morning.....I showed him the new +.030 pistons and told him that big blocks before 1975 can be bored +.060, not that this one needs to be bored, just taken apart, cleaned, honed, and put back together with new gaskets.
Like I said, it was CLEAN inside, and no perceptible ridge at the top of the cylinder. someday when you have a few minutes, just pay the $1 to get in, then on the back of the entrance shed is a long price sheet. You might want to just stand there and read it. Once you have an idea how cheap things are there, then the trick is to find stuff that is relatively new. this truck is a prime example, it was in there because the transmission was shot, but the motor was a screaming deal at regular prices, and at half price even better.
